Output 3bb81ec971b10303bdc277317038e0d8b291cb6e79b33039e65c7fdd5315f3d4:1

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f831cbe5a7330568835355eed836f9847ed819a OP_EQUAL
address
37UqZUDCa2953Kf4YXiAE91TqRvQnbzXek
transaction
3bb81ec971b10303bdc277317038e0d8b291cb6e79b33039e65c7fdd5315f3d4
confirmations
546596
spent
true